Transaction e59ddcd84a48df2f5e3e4a5e26e888800f58433fed9b1ddcd9eb7aabd34901e4
1 Input
1 Output
-
e59ddcd84a48df2f5e3e4a5e26e888800f58433fed9b1ddcd9eb7aabd34901e4:0
- value
- 998870
- script pubkey
- OP_0 OP_PUSHBYTES_20 f731f986fd117e7bcd66465d4645455661acf5a9
- address
- bc1q7uclnphaz9l8hntxgew5v3292es6eadfnp97vz